## Catalog Cache Environments — Pebblemart

Quick notes for release managers: the Pebblemart catalog service runs in dev, staging, and prod, each with its own invalidation fanout. Staging purges on every publish; prod batches invalidations every 30s to spare the origin. Don't ship a release without confirming the purge queue is drained. Current environment settings for the invalidation worker follow.

deployment values, faduf-tawep:
SORDOR_LOG_LEVEL=error
SORDOR_METRICS_HOST=metrics.sordor.nelvrolabs.internal
SORDOR_POOL_SIZE=4

☐ Replica lag alarm — Key ceremony step 4 (Quorlane Systems). Confirm the Pellwick read-replica lag alarm is silenced before rotating the signing key; re-arm it immediately after. If rotation stalls past 10 minutes, abort and restore from the sealed bundle. Verify checksum against the ceremony log, then unseal the recovery vault. The passphrase for the sealed bundle is below.

recovery phrase for fawif-tajeg: norael-aldmir-casir-brivan-ulaion

Subject: Update on Project Lanthorn delay

Team, Project Lanthorn, our internal billing-platform migration, is now tracking eight weeks behind schedule due to data-validation failures in the Orvick module. Remediation costs are estimated at an additional 4% of the approved budget. Revised milestones will reach you Thursday. Please treat the planning note appended below as strictly confidential.

confidential, bahap-bajog: Zorethix Works is in early talks to buy Kelethox Foods for about $30.7 million. The Ralvan launch date is September 19, and nothing goes to the press before then.